Powering Tampa's Future: Lithium Battery Firm Drops $4M on Cutting-Edge Manufacturing Hub

A leading US-based lithium battery manufacturer is set to revolutionize battery production with a substantial $4 million investment in a cutting-edge 60,000 square foot automated manufacturing facility in Tampa, Florida. This strategic expansion goes beyond traditional manufacturing, featuring a sophisticated Foreign Trade Zone (FTZ) designation and five highly specialized assembly lines.
The state-of-the-art facility is strategically designed to support critical sectors, including:
• Defense contract requirements
• Advanced artificial intelligence (AI) data center energy storage solutions
• Original Equipment Manufacturer (OEM) strategic partnerships
